Initially, let’s define the three main types of cannabis seeds: regular, feminized, and auto-flowering. Regular seeds can produce male or female plants, making them ideal for breeders who wish to create their hybrids or protect genes.
Feminized seeds, on the other hand, are genetically customized to produce only female plants. This is a popular option for growers who wish to guarantee they are getting the most out of their crop, as female plants are the ones that produce buds.
Finally, auto-flowering seeds are a newer advancement in the marijuana world and are developed to automatically change from the vegetative to the flowering phase, regardless of the light cycle. This makes them a practical option for outdoor grows, as they can be planted later in the season and still produce a harvest.

Regular seeds: As pointed out, regular seeds are not genetically modified and can produce male or female plants. This makes them a good option for breeders or those wanting to protect genes. However, for many growers, there are more efficient options than regular seeds. Because you have a 50/50 opportunity of getting a male plant that does not produce buds, you’ll conserve time and resources on plants that will not add to your harvest. In addition, male plants can fertilize female plants, growing seeds in your buds (likewise known as “seedy bud”). While some people might incline this, the majority of growers choose seedless buds.
Feminized seeds: They are the most popular choice among growers, as they are specifically developed to produce female plants. This implies you can be sure that every seed you plant will turn into a bud-producing plant, optimizing your yield and lessening the risk of squandering resources on male plants. Feminized seeds are created by stressing a female plant into producing male flowers, which are then pollinated with another female plant. The resulting seeds will be feminized, producing just female plants. While feminized seeds are a hassle-free choice for most growers, it deserves noting that they might not be suitable for breeding or protecting genes, as they do not consist of the full genetic variety of regular seeds.
Autoflowering seeds: Autoflowering seeds are a newer development in the marijuana world and are created to immediately switch from the vegetative to the flowering phase, regardless of the light cycle. This makes them a convenient option for outdoor grows, as they can be planted later on in the season and still produce a harvest. Autoflowering seeds are also a good choice for indoor grows where the light cycle can not be accurately controlled, as they are not dependent on a specific light schedule to start the flowering phase.Online Cannabis Seed Banks
Nevertheless, it’s worth noting that auto-flowering pressures tend to be smaller sized and produce lower yields compared to photoperiod stress (which do require a specific light schedule to start the flowering stage). When purchasing marijuana seeds online, there are a few essential things to consider to guarantee you are getting premium seeds that will produce a successful crop. Here are the leading 10 things to search for when purchasing seeds online:
The credibility of the seed bank: Pick a respectable seed bank with a performance history of offering premium seeds. Search for reviews and do your research to guarantee you are dealing with a genuine business.
Seed quality: Make certain the seeds are fresh and practical. Old or broken seeds are less likely to germinate and produce a successful crop.
Strain info: Try to find in-depth info about the strain you buy, including its genes, development characteristics, and meant use.
Payment and shipping choices: Inspect to see what payment approaches the seed bank accepts and how they deal with shipping. Pick a seed bank that uses safe payment options and discreet shipping to guarantee privacy.Online Cannabis Seed Banks
Germination warranty: Look for a seed bank that offers a germination warranty, suggesting they will change any seeds that do not germinate.
Customer support: Select a seed bank with a responsive and practical customer service team available to address any questions or issues.
Seed variety: Look for a seed bank that provides various pressures, consisting of popular and uncommon types.
Product packaging: Examine how the seeds are packaged to ensure they get here in good condition.
Legal compliance: Ensure the seed bank is running legally and in compliance with all pertinent laws and guidelines.
Rate: Compare rates from different seed banks to ensure you get a bargain. Nevertheless, be aware that cheaper seeds might sometimes be of a different quality than more costly seeds.

To grow marijuana, you will require a couple of basic products in addition to the seeds. Here is a list of a few of the things you will need to get started:
Growing area: You will need a space to grow your plants, whether a dedicated grow room, a greenhouse, or an outside grow. Make sure the location has good ventilation and appropriates for the size and kind of plants you plan to grow.
Growing medium: The most common growing mediums for cannabis are soil, coco coir, and hydroponics. Choose a growing medium suitable for the type of grow you are preparing.Online Cannabis Seed Banks
Nutrients: Your plants will need a source of nutrients to grow. This can be in the form of a soil mix that is already changed with nutrients, or you can utilize a separate nutrient solution for hydroponic grows.
Lighting: Appropriate lighting is necessary for healthy plant growth. Pick a lighting system that appropriates for the size of your grow space and the type of plants you are growing.
Watering system: You will need a method to water your plants. This can be as simple as a watering can or a more intricate drip watering system.
Pest control: Pests can be a problem for cannabis grows. Keep an eye out for common pests and be prepared to take action if needed.Online Cannabis Seed Banks
Pruning tools: Pruning your plants can help enhance the total health and yield of your crop. Make certain you have the right tools for the job, such as pruning shears or scissors.
Harvesting tools: When it’s time to collect your plants, you will need some standard tools to help you cut and dry your buds. This might consist of trimming scissors, drying racks, and treating jars.
